Breaking: The FDA Creates a Path for Psychedelic Drug Trials "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) recently released first-ever draft guidance, making way for psychedelic drug trials. This ground-breaking move may facilitate the mainstream acceptance of substances such as magic mushrooms and LSD as potential treatments for behavioral health conditions.

The Significance of the FDAs New Move

The ramifications of this development are far-reaching. Psychedelics are now on the cusp of becoming a multi-billion-dollar industry and gaining widespread acceptance after years of apprehension due to recreational use of these substances, coupled with their high risk of misuse.

Yet, the bulk of research conducted to date has been primarily backed by private sponsors. This scenario may change with the FDAs novel initiative, bringing the promising potential of these substances into the limelight.

The FDAs Decision in Detail

The FDAs decision, outlined in a 14-page document, proposes guidelines on conducting trials, collecting data, and ensuring subject safety for researchers exploring psychedelic treatments for various conditions. These range from PTSD, depression, and anxiety, to a variety of other mental health disorders.

This guidance came hot on the heels of the introduction of new legislation by a bipartisan coalition in Congress, led by Rep. Dan Crenshaw (R-Texas), which directed the issuance of clinical trial guidelines. The legislation, House Bill 4242, represents an important step in establishing regulatory frameworks for psychedelic research.

The Largest Psychedelic Conference in History

Interestingly, the FDAs announcement coincided with the largest psychedelic conference in history held in Denver. This conference saw participation from a wide spectrum of attendees, from New York Jets quarterback Aaron Rodgers to National Institute of Mental Health director Joshua Gordon, indicating the growing interest in this field.

Photographer Captures Hunting Prowess of Bald Eagles Catching Fish and Eating It in Mid-Air "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

Photographer Captures Hunting Prowess of Bald Eagles Catching Fish and Eating It in Mid-Air

Bald Eagle by Mark Smith Photography

Bald eagles are impressive animals. As one of the largest raptors in the world, they can have a wingspan of up to 8 feet. Expert hunters, they live near water to have a constant supply of fish, turtles, ducks, and snakes. And when they spot a tasty snack, they can swoop down at up to 100 miles per hour and pluck their prey from the water. It sounds incredible on paper, but the visual is even better.

Thankfully, Mark Smith is an expert at capturing video of the precise moment when bald eagles strike. His recordings, which he posts to his popular Instagram, pay homage to the power and glory of this bird, which has been a symbol of America since the 18th century. In one clip, the bald eagle flies down with determination and, after it's gotten the fish in its talons, swallows it whole while in mid-air.

As Smith frequents an area where a large bald eagle population is present, he notes that they are often competing for food. This most likely accounts for why the eagle wasn't taking any chances with its catch. They often have to eat on the wing in order to avoid theft or confrontation, he tells My Modern Met.

In another video, the eagle leisurely glides sideways to the surface of the water. The large fish it ultimately grabs is helpless as the eagle flies off into the sky with it tightly clutched between its talons. And while their dives into the water are impressive, this isn't the only way that eagles hunt.

Smith was able to capture a video of a bald eagle slowly making its way across a bed of oysters to snatch a fish with its beak. As it stalked its prey, the bird's gaze intensified. Only once the fish was in its mouth did the raptor take in its surrounding, even looking right at the camera.

For Smith, the opportunity to see these moments is priceless. Thankfully, he's happy to share his work so that everyone can appreciate the power and grace of these raptors.

Binance Rescinds Decision To Remove Privacy Coins From European Market "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

Binance has made a decision to reverse its initial plan of delisting certain privacy coins in Europe. This change in course comes after the exchange revised its operations to align with the local regulatory requirements.

According to the developers of Verge (XVG) and Secret (SCRT) cryptocurrencies, a significant outcome was achieved. Seven privacy-focused tokens were stopped from being de-listed. These tokens, which were at risk of being removed from the listings, have been successfully retained.

A comment received from the cryptocurrency exchange on June 26 states:

After carefully considering feedback from our community and several projects, we have revised how we classify privacy coins on our platform to comply with EU-wide regulatory requirements.

The crypto exchange also mentioned that due to its status as a registered exchange in multiple European Union jurisdictions, it is obligated to comply with local regulations.

These regulations mandate that exchanges have the capability to monitor transactions involving the coins listed on their platform.

In May, Binance communicated via email to its customers in France, Italy, Spain, and Poland regarding changes to its services. The message outlined the discontinuation of trading services for 12 cryptocurrencies known for enabling anonymous transactions.

Related Reading: Avalanche (AVAX) Rumbles With 18% Gain Is A Trend Reversal On The Horizon?

Prominent privacy coins such as Monero, Dash, and Zcash were among those affected. Additionally, lesser-known tokens like XVG and SCRT were also scheduled for delisting from the exchanges offerings.

Following the retraction of the decision to delist privacy-focused tokens, several projects have utilized Twitter as a platform to provide reassurance to their community members.

Binance Complies As EU Sets Standards For Digital Assets

The decision to delist privacy-focused tokens came as a response to the European Unions implementation of the Markets in Crypto Assets (MiCA) regulation.

This regulation includes the travel rule for crypto transactions, which requires enhanced transparency and information sharing. Consequently, there is a potential risk for firms facilitating the trading of privacy coins to be non-compliant with EU law.

EU policymakers have established clear regulations with the goal of positioning Europe as a leading h...

Brilliant Sculptural Stories Unfold From Carefully Crafted Pages of Books "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

Brilliant Sculptural Stories Unfold From Carefully Crafted Pages of Books

Book Sculptures by Emma Taylor

Usually, when we read, the story comes alive in our heads. UK-based artist Emma Taylor takes this experience to a new level in her incredible book sculptures. Using discarded texts, she crafts three-dimensional animals and objects from the pages. From ships that sprout from antique atlases to insects flying from animal guides, these carefully-modeled sculptures playfully interact with their original source.

Taylor spends countless hours finding materials for her art. In particular, upcycling old or abandoned books (typically from the early 20th century) is an integral part of her practice. In my work, I give new life to old books by creating intricate sculptures which appear to emerge directly from the paper pages, Taylor explains to My Modern Met. The often minute details I create draw the viewer into each sculpture, as fine strips of text are transformed into rigging on a seafaring galleon, printed words become individual feathers shaping a birds wing or singular letters form the bricks of grand buildings.

For Taylor, choosing the right book comes down to instinct. She says that certain texts inspire her immediately, while in other cases, she sometimes has to seek out a specific book for an idea she already has in mind. Nature is an endless source of inspiration for me with trees in particular being a recurrent theme, she adds. Each tree I make references the origin of the paper itself as I transform the paper pages back into trunks and branches; also connecting the wisdom of ancient trees to the wisdom contained within many books.

Major Breakthrough: How Botox enters brain cells, a discovery that could save lives "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

A groundbreaking study led by distinguished researchers from the University of Queensland has unveiled new insights about the complex mechanism through which Botox infiltrates brain cells. The profound findings, published in The EMBO Journal, are set to have a substantial impact on the medical and cosmetic industries and potentially pioneer new treatments for botulism.

Botox: A Multifaceted Tool from Bacterial Origins to Beauty Regimes

The team spearheaded by Professor Frederic Meunier and Dr. Merja Joensuu from the Queensland Brain Institute at the University of Queensland, successfully pinpointed the specific molecular pathway through which the botulinum neurotoxin type-A, popularly known as Botox, infiltrates neurons.

A compound released by the bacterium Clostridium botulinum, Botox has a long and intriguing history. Its initial medical application was in the treatment of strabismus, a condition characterized by misalignment of the eyes. Over time, its therapeutic applications expanded to include treatments for spasms, migraines, and even excessive sweating as documented by the Mayo Clinic and Hopkins Medicine.

Interestingly, Botoxs most widely recognized use today is in the cosmetic industry, where its employed to smooth wrinkles and rejuvenate the skin. However, the benefits of Botox go beyond the aesthetic realm. When deployed medically, Botox injections can provide various health benefits, such as:

  • Alleviating chronic migraines: Regular Botox treatments can decrease the frequency of migraine attacks.
  • Reducing hyperhidrosis: Botox can be used to manage excessive sweating.
  • Treating muscle spasticity: Botox injections can relax muscles and improve mobility.
  • Managing eye conditions: Early use of Botox was to address strabismus and blepharospasm (abnormal contraction of the eyelid muscles).
  • Reducing overactive bladder symptoms: Botox has shown positive results in controlling urinary incontinence.

However, despite its numerous benefits, its critical to note that when botulinum toxin is released in large quantities by the bacterium Clostridium botulinum, it can cause the potentially lethal disease botulism.

Community Shares | June 26th 2023 "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

  • The first person to be diagnosed with autism has died at age 89. Donald Triplett, passed away from cancer in his hometown of Forest, Mississippi. Leo Kanner published his seminal paper Autistic Disturbances of Affective Contact in 1943, which outlined data on eleven children with similar behaviors. Donald was part of Kanners original cohort and considered case number one. Kanner used the term early infantile autism when diagnosing Triplett that same year. 
  • According to a new brief report, the majority of school-age children with autism living in an urban and ethnically diverse population presented with one or more comorbid diagnoses. Specifically, elementary school-age children were more likely to have an additional diagnosis of language disorder and attention-de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D). At the same time, adolescents were more likely to be diagnosed with depression. 
  • New research shows that health changes or illnesses can cause challenging behaviors in people with autism. Specifically, the authors found that appetite or dietary preferences, irritability and low mood, and loss of previously acquired skills were associated with changes in health. Based on these findings, the researchers suggest that caregivers should look for distress behaviors to better manage healthcare for those on the spectrum. 
  • The North Syracuse Central School District has settled a lawsuit for $1.55 million that alleged a student with autism did not receive the proper resources and care. The family sued in 2018 when their son was five, claiming that the district refused to provide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) therapy and...

Sweden Examines Health Outcomes for Older Adults with Autism "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

Study Shows Group Is at Higher Risk of Bodily Injuries, Heart Failure, Cystitis, Glucose Dysregulation, Iron Deficiency, Poisoning, and Self-Harm

The health outcomes of older adults with autism (45 years) have been sparsely studied over the years, leading to a lack of knowledge about the impact of intellectual disability and gender on the overall health patterns of this vulnerable population. However, recent research conducted in Sweden sought to fill this gap in knowledge. A research team conducted a longitudinal, retrospective, population-based cohort study of the Swedish population born between Jan 1, 1932, and Dec 31, 1967, to investigate the association between autism and physical health conditions in older adults. Using linked data from the nationwide Total Population Register and the National Patient Register, the authors investigated the association between autism and various physical health conditions in older adults, considering intellectual disability and gender. They discovered that older adults with autism had higher cumulative incidence and hazard ratios of physical conditions and injuries than their non-autistic counterparts. Specifically, they were at an increased risk of bodily injuries, heart failure, cystitis, glucose dysregulation or dysglycemia, iron deficiency or anemia, poisoning, and self-harm. These risks were observed regardless of intellectual disability or gender. The authors conclude that their findings highlight the importance of collaborative efforts from researchers and health service policymakers to provide older individuals with autism the necessary support to attain healthy longevity and high quality of life.

Vitamin D Supplementation During the First 2 Years of Life Decreased the Risk of Psychiatric Problems in Later Childhood "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

High-Dose (1200 IU) vs. Standard-Dose (400 IU) until Age 2 Showed Less Internalizing Behaviors at Ages 6 to 8

A recent international investigation has examined the potential effects of high-dose vitamin D3 supplementation on psychiatric symptoms in healthy infants up to the age of 2 years. The study found that children who received a daily 1200-IU oral vitamin D3 supplement had a lower prevalence of clinically significant internalizing behaviors (e.g., symptoms of depression, loneliness, and anxiety) than those who received the standard recommended dose of 400 IU. Interestingly, the authors did not find any differences in externalizing behaviors (e.g., oppositional defiance disorder, conduct disorder, and antisocial personality disorder) between the two groups. The study also found that children from the 400-IU group with maternal 25(OH)D levels less than 30 ng/mL during pregnancy had significantly higher internalizing problem scores than children from the 1200-IU group, regardless of maternal 25(OH)D status. While previous studies have suggested that higher 25(OH)D levels during fetal life and early childhood may lower the risk of childhood psychopathology, this is the first randomized controlled trial to assess the potential impact of high-dose vitamin D3 supplementation in healthy infants and up to the age of 2 years on psychiatric symptoms during late preschool and early school age. The authors recommend that their findings be interpreted in context with outcomes related to childrens health related to growth patterns and allergies since lower doses of vitamin D3 were found to be more beneficial during infancy for those conditions.

Lightning Network Hits Record Highs In Bitcoin And US Dollar Capacity "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

The Lightning Network, Bitcoins Layer 2 payment protocol, has achieved a new landmark, reaching an all-time high in Bitcoin capacity, a pivotal move underscoring the networks continued growth and increased adoption.

The network, which works by locking Bitcoin in payment channels, witnessed a substantial boost, pushing its Bitcoin capacity to a record-high of more than 5,500 BTC for the first time since April, according to data from The Block.

This monumental achievement signifies not just the robust growth of the network, but also the increasing confidence in the Lightning Network as a viable payment protocol.

Surge In Bitcoin Network Capacity

According to The Block, this past Saturday, the Lightning Network attained an apex in capacity, hitting 5,630 BTC. This figure surpasses the prior peak of 5,620 BTC recorded on April 18. Concurrently, the networks US Dollar capacity also reached an all-time high, topping $172 million.

Related Reading: Nansen Forecast For Bitcoin Bull Run: Regulatory Clarity And Lower Inflation

The Block noted, as these numbers reveal, Lightning Networks capacity has grown significantly, increasing 42% in Bitcoin and 105% in US Dollar terms over the last 12 months. This considerable advancement is a testament to the ongoing acceptance and utilization of the Lightning Network in the crypto world.

The Future Of Lightning Network

David Marcus, CEO of enterprise-grade Lightning Network firm Lightspark, emphasized the importance of expanding the networks infrastructure and capacity.

Marcus said the reason for this was Particularly because we can actually guarantee that even larger payments succeed on Lightning, which in the past has been pretty hard to achieve.

Envisioning the future, Marcus explained that this development could enable any enterprise out there to access a real-time, super low-cost settlement network for the internet thats interoperable, thats open, that any developer can build on.

Notably, Marcus underscored the need for the greater exchange involved in the network, arguing that this would not only bolster Bitcoin mobility but also enhance the Lightning Network on and off-ramps. Moreover, the Lightning Networks success in Bitcoin a...

Bitcoin Bullish Signal: Exchange Whale Ratio Plunges "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

On-chain data shows that the Bitcoin exchange whale ratio has taken a plunge recently. Heres why this may be bullish for the assets price.

Bitcoin Exchange Whale Ratio Has Registered A Sharp Decline Recently

As pointed out by an analyst in a CryptoQuant post, the selling pressure in the market may be diminishing right now. The exchange whale ratio is an indicator that measures the ratio between the sum of the top ten Bitcoin transactions to exchanges and the total exchange inflow.

Generally, the 10 largest transactions to exchanges are coming from whale entities, so this metric can tell us how the inflows of these humongous holders compare with that of the entire market.

When the value of this ratio is high, it means that the whales are making up a large part of the total inflows currently. As one of the main reasons why investors deposit to exchanges is for selling-related purposes, this kind of trend can be a sign that this cohort may be taking part in mass dumping right now.

On the other hand, low values of the indicator imply the whales are contributing a relatively healthy portion toward the inflows at the moment. Since these large investors arent selling significantly more than the rest of the market during such periods, the price of the cryptocurrency can feel a bullish effect.

Now, here is a chart that shows the trend in the 72-hour simple moving average (SMA) Bitcoin exchange whale ratio over the past several months:

Bitcoin Exchange Whale Ratio

As displayed in the above graph, the 72-hour SMA Bitcoin exchange whale ratio has plummeted recently, implying that the whale deposits have dropped relative to the rest of the market.

Before this plunge, the indicator had been in an overall uptrend since March, suggesting that these humongous investors were possibly slowly ramping up their selling.

During the recent period when the assets price was struggling, the metric had surged to around 0.88, meaning that around 88% of the total exchange inflows were coming from this cohort alone.

Following the latest rapid decline, however, the 72-hour SMA Bitcoin exchange whale ratio has dropped to around 0.80. Interestingly, this drawdown in the indicator has come while the coin has seen a...

Editor wont investigate data concerns about paper linking anti-prostitution laws to increased rape "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

After reading an economics paper that claimed to document an increase in the rate of rape in European countries following the passage of prostitution bans, a data scientist had questions. 

The scientist, who wishes to remain anonymous, sent a detailed email to an editor of the Journal of Law and Economics, which had published the paper last November, outlining concerns about the data and methods the authors used. 

Among them: the historical rates of rape recorded in the paper did not match the values in the official sources the authors said they used. In other cases, data that were available from the official sources were missing in the paper, the researchers didnt incorporate all the data they had collected into their model, and a variable was coded inconsistently, the data scientist wrote. (Weve made the full critique available here.)

Given the consequences the conclusions of the article could have for people in the sex industry, the data scientist wrote, I hope that someone takes this very seriously and looks into it the [sic] validity of the analysis and the data they used. 

In response, Sam Peltzman, an editor of the journal and a professor emeritus of economics at the University of Chicagos Booth School of Business, instructed the data scientist to contact the authors of the article: 

The email raises serious questions but without any specific request. Your questions can better be answered by the authors than editors who, as you must know, cannot give each submission the kind of careful attention reflected in your email. Accordingly, we ask that you contact the authors directly if you have not already done so.

If you mean the email as a prologue to a critique, I am happy to discuss our relevant policies or any other question about our editorial process.

The data scientist wrote back with a specific request: 

I have just informed you, the editor, that it appears that the authors made an error in at least one of their models that resulted in a substantive difference in the con...

Watch Mall City, the Original Gonzo Documentary That Captures the Height of Shopping-Mall Culture (1983) "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

httvs://www.youtube.com/watch?v=YmWTHCHHzZY

No American who came of age in the nineteen-eighties or in most of the seventies or nineties, for that matter could pretend not to understand the importance of the mall. Edina, Minnesotas Southdale Center, which defined the modern shopping malls enclosed, department store-anchored form, opened in 1956. Over the decades that followed, living patterns suburbanized and developers responded by plunging into a long and profitable orgy of mall-building, with the result that generations of adolescents lived in reasonably easy reach of such a commercial institution. Some came to shop and others came to work, but if Hugh Kinniburghs documentary Mall City is to be believed, most came just to hang out.

Introduced as A SAFARI TO STUDY MALL CULTURE, Mall City consists of interviews conducted by Kinniburgh and his NYU Film School collaborators during one day in 1983 at the Roosevelt Field Mall on Long Island. Unsurprisingly, their interviewees tend to be young, strenuously coiffed, and dressed with studied nonchalance in striped T-shirts and Members Only-style windbreakers.

How Colostrum Can Benefit Your Immune Health "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

For the first three to four days after giving birth, all mammals, including humans, produce colostrum, also known as initial milk or first milk.1 Rich in enzymes, hormones, growth factors, cytokines and immune cells, this thick, yellow substance is produced only in small quantities, but is packed with so much nutrition that it easily meets the needs of the growing newborn during the first days of life.

About 250 active compounds have been identified in colostrum, but there are likely many others.2 Colostrum contains beneficial bacteria, as well, and acts directly on the babys tissues, ensuring optimal growth and development of the nervous, digestive and immune systems. As explained by researchers with Hirszfeld Institute of Immunology and Experimental Therapy in Wroclaw, Poland:3

"The nutrients and regulatory substances ensure normal growth, differentiation, maturation and function of the digestive system, protect against damage and allow it to heal, control the development of a normal intestinal microbiota and shape the local (gut-related) and systemic immune response."

Given the immense benefits of colostrum to newborns, its also been harnessed for its disease prevention, wellness and antiaging potential, particularly as it relates to immune system function.

Colostrum for Immune System health

Bovine colostrum contains similar bioactive components as human colostrum, albeit in different concentrations.4 Given its widespread availability, its been used for health purposes for thousands of years, including to heal wounds and protect against infection.5

Its believed that cytokines, immunoglobulins, growth factors, antimicrobial compounds and maternal immune cells are also transferred when colostrum is fed, supporting immunity.6 In fact, colostrum is so beneficial its often referred to as "liquid gold" or "immune milk."7 "Naturally produced bioactive components, immunoglobulins lay the foundation of life-long immunity," researchers explained in Food Bioscience.8

Immunoglobulin G (IgG) is the most common antibody in bovine colostrum (BC), making up 80% to 85% of the immunoglobulin present. The Food Bioscience team noted:9

Why a Germ Expert Is Begging You To Remove the Foil or Plastic Seal Under the Lid of Your Containers After Opening "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

If you frequent Reddit or engage in household debates on food storage, youve likely encountered the controversy surrounding foil or plastic seals on food products like yogurt and sour cream. Should these seals be removed or retained for additional coverage after opening? One couple debated this question for an impressive ten years before a directive from the very product in question solved their quandary. The husband found the unexpected resolution under the contentious disposable seal, which was imprinted with a manufacturers instruction: To prolong freshness, completely remove and discard this foil seal.

This straightforward message from the product manufacturer may solve the debate, but it still leaves us wondering about the original purpose of the seals. Moreover, how can leaving these seals on an opened container compromise the freshness of its contents? In pursuit of these answers, we consulted two renowned germ experts.

Understanding the Purpose of Foil or Plastic Seals on Food Containers

According to Jason Tetro, a respected microbiologist and author of the book The Germ Files, there are two primary reasons for the existence of these seals. Firstly, it helps to increase shelf lifethe container is usually flushed with nitrogen before sealing, which reduces the amount of oxygen inside, he explains. Nitrogen flushing is a common technique used by food manufacturers to prolong the shelf-life of their products. The reduction of oxygen inside the container is intended to suppress the growth of aerobic bacteria and fungi, which can cause food to spoil.

Secondly, these seals serve as a protective barrier for the containers contents. It helps to prevent the introduction of chemicals and microbes that could spoil the products and/or cause illnesses, states Tetro.

Adding further clarity to this matter, microbial ecologist Jack A. Gilbert, Ph.D., a professor at the University of California San Diego, elaborates on the importance of the seal. He describes it as a safety and quality mechanism. It works by creating a barrier between the product and the external environment while also providing assurance to consumers that the product has not been tampered with prior to purchase.

 

Removing the Seal Post-Opening: A Crucial Practice for Food Safety

This Is What Antarctica Looks Like Beneath the Ice "IndyWatch Feed Allcommunity"

This Is What Antarctica Looks Like Beneath the Ice

Antarctica Without Ice: What Would That Look Like?

The Bedmap2 topography beneath Antarctic ice. (Photo: NASA/Goddard Space Flight Center)

The ice caps are melting. Sea levels will rise. Climate change is reshaping the Earth. But what would an iceless world look like? NASA has an idea. In 2013, NASA created Bedmap2, a detailed topographical modelor suite of gridded productsshowing the bedrock landscape underneath icy Antarctica, as well as sea elevation. Through radar technology and detailed data collection of 25 million measurements, Bedmap2 provides insight into a changing world.

The original Bedmap was created in 2001. Bedmap2 uses a lot more data to create a compilation of knowledge surrounding the Antarctic region south of 60 degrees south. Surface elevation, ice thickness, and bedrock topography data from NASA and the British Antarctic Survey help paint a detailed picture of a hidden world. While Antarctica is 98% covered by ice, underneath is a range of rock mountains and gorges. Using radar technology, known as Multichannel Coherent Radar Depth Sounder, researchers discovered the lowest point on the continent: 9,416 feet below sea level under Byrd Glacier.

Ice sheets grow because of snow, and like honey poured on a plate, spread outward and thin due to their own weight, Sophie Nowicki, of NASA's Goddard Space Flight Center said in a statement. The shape of the bed is the most important unknown, and affect how ice can flow. You can influence how honey spreads on your plate, by simply varying how you hold your plate.

The shape of the rock bed is particularly important for calculating how climate change will impact Antarctica and the world. 6.4 million cubic miles of ice could create a 190-foot sea-level rise. In fact, sea levels are...
